VAT & Sales Tax Comparison

Standard VAT/GST rates by country (2024). The US has no federal value-added tax; state sales taxes range from 0% to about 10%.

Country Standard rate Notes
Hungary 27%
Sweden 25%
Denmark 25%
Norway 25%
Croatia 25%
Finland 24%
Greece 24%
Poland 23%
Portugal 23%
Ireland 23%
Italy 22%
Slovenia 22%
Estonia 22%
Spain 21%
Netherlands 21%
Belgium 21%
Latvia 21%
Lithuania 21%
Czech Republic 21%
Austria 20%
Bulgaria 20%
Slovakia 20%
United Kingdom 20%
France 20%
Turkey 20%
Romania 19%
Germany 19%
Chile 19%
Colombia 19%
Luxembourg 17%
Israel 17%
Mexico 16%
New Zealand 15%
Australia 10%
Japan 10%
South Korea 10%
Switzerland 8.1%
Canada 5% GST 5%; provinces add 0–10%
United States No federal VAT; state sales tax 0–10%

VAT vs sales tax

VAT (Value Added Tax) is applied at each stage of production. Sales tax is typically applied only at the final sale. The EU requires a minimum 15% VAT; many countries apply 19–27%. The US is the only OECD country without a federal VAT.
